PSP announces rally after Eid
KARACHI (DNA) – Pak Sarzameen Party (PSP) has announced to hold rally after Eid.
Addressing to media in Pakistan House Karachi, the leader of PSP Anees Qaimkhani said our rally after Eid will show our power adding that the politics of change and linguistic have been rejected by people.
People of Sindh are with us and Mustafa Kamal will solve the problems of Sindh, he added.
He expressed that poor of this country now thinks to manage the budget of Rs20,000 instead of Rs10,000. He said people were ruined in the name of change.
PSP leader said people have rejected the rallies of PPP and MQM, adding that PSP was only party to play a role of opposition.
